Output 38075966c12585319c8c65d7d3d4d1c3be5f68a7c1efc4842471dc152796bda6:1

value
2290020
script pubkey
OP_0 OP_PUSHBYTES_20 5f240d5cd901ed2355492d25d062ef71dcedf992
address
ltc1qtujq6hxeq8kjx42f95jaqch0w8wwm7vjxpnqvs
transaction
38075966c12585319c8c65d7d3d4d1c3be5f68a7c1efc4842471dc152796bda6
spent
true